PATTERN: I used Simplicity 1077, view B as a base and made the following alterations:
- Deepen the keyhole on the back by 2 inches to make is more dramatic
- Lengthened the top back and front by 6 inches
- drafted a facing for the front and back since I wanted a clean finish as opposed to hemming the keyhole and armholes.
- Got rid of the waist band
SEWING : The top was easy to sew. I used my serger. Since I added a front and back facing, I confused myself a bit.. I usually don’t read pattern instructions.. If you are not doing a facing, this is a one hour top. Easy!
FABRIC: A ribbed knit from Joanns fabric. It was $6.99 a yard. Very casual knit but I put a more dressy twist on it
